Andrea Gaudenzi was the defending champion but lost in the first round to Gorka Fraile.

Carlos Moyá won in the final 6–3, 2–6, 7–5 against Younes El Aynaoui.

Seeds

A champion seed is indicated in bold text while text in italics indicates the round in which that seed was eliminated.

  1. Argentina Guillermo Cañas (quarterfinals)
  2. Morocco Younes El Aynaoui (final)
  3. Spain Carlos Moyá (champion)
  4. Spain Tommy Robredo (semifinals)
  5. Finland Jarkko Nieminen (first round)
  6. Chile Fernando González (second round)
  7. Argentina Mariano Zabaleta (second round)
  8. Sweden Jonas Björkman (first round)
